**Ticket FIN-2087: Rounding drift in Drachmel conversion service**

Converting 10.005 units via the Korvane rates endpoint yields results off by one minor unit, because rounding happens before the spread is applied. Repro: post the sample payload in the attached fixture to staging and compare against the ledger. Authenticate the staging request with the token below.

session JWT of yawep-yawep = eyJhbGciOiJIUzI1NiIsInR5cCI6IkpXVCJ9.eyJzdWIiOiI3pWF3_In0.aXYsHiog

## Request Tracing Overview

All services in the Bramblewood platform propagate a trace header minted by the Lanternfish gateway. When paged for latency spikes, start by pulling the full trace from the Cinderpath collector rather than grepping individual pod logs — spans from the checkout, ledger, and notification services are stitched there automatically. Sampling is 100% for errors and 5% otherwise. To query the Cinderpath trace API during an incident, authenticate with the on-call key below.

gateway credential: kto23_LX9A4ys6i4nzHtpOLNLodKK

## FAQ: How are user-supplied formulas sandboxed in Calqshell?

Plugin authors: every formula your plugin submits runs inside the Calqshell sandbox — no filesystem, network, or host-object access, with a strict 50ms evaluation budget. Do not attempt to escape via recursion tricks; the interpreter terminates and quarantines offending plugins. If your plugin is quarantined during testing, you can self-restore it once per day through the developer console, which asks for your recovery credential, the passphrase below.

vault phrase of kawep-tahog = ulaix-briath

The DeployHerald bot posts deploy status updates to the release channel whenever Quillway's pipeline transitions between stages. Release managers can query current rollout state via GET /v2/status or subscribe to webhook pushes for specific environments. All requests must authenticate against the internal Herald gateway. Use the key below for staging and production queries alike.

API key for fahip-kahip: zpat23_XiJGUHz5xfaAtaIqUkus0rh